When I turn my windows firewall off Windows Security Center states that it
it detects more than one firewall installed on this computer...

I can't for the life me find this other firewall that is supposed to be
installed on my computer...

I have no other firewall software installed on my computer...

Why is it telling me I have more than one???...

Is there a way to find out what firewall it is detecting???...

The only firewall I use is Windows...

I use AVG AntiVirus and SpySweeper but this software doesn't have
firewalls...

i use to get double firewall msg's too. i think it was due to either windows
defender or that one care by microsoft. have you checked your system
processes and services? in services, you may find an entry for a firewall
that is in addition to the "windows firewall" service. I think that "one
care" was a service installed. but i uninstalled the one care. with system
processes, you can download "ProcessLibrary.com QuickAccess" (or something
similar) which will give you detailed data about each process in your task
manager (ctrl+alt+del). also, i think that some routers, mainly the
expensive ones, also have a firewall.
